Course Content

• Introduction to 2D Materials: Properties and Synthesis
• 2D Materials for Augmented Reality Displays: Enhancing Visual Quality
• Characterization Techniques for 2D Materials: Microscopy and Spectroscopy
• Flexible and Stretchable Electronics using 2D Materials for AR Devices
• Graphene and other 2D Materials in AR Sensors: Improved Sensitivity and Performance
• Device Fabrication Techniques for 2D Material-Based AR Components
• Applications of 2D Materials in Augmented Reality Headsets: Lightweight and Efficient Designs
• The Future of 2D Materials in Augmented Reality: Emerging Trends and Challenges
• Commercialization and Business Aspects of 2D Materials in AR
• Safety and Environmental Considerations of 2D Material Applications in AR
